Part 1: Processing Styles - Visual, Audio, and Kinesthetic

When it comes to information processing, people tend to have a default or preferred mode: visual, auditory, or kinesthetic. Visual processors create mental images or pictures of the information they are storing or retrieving. Auditory processors hear the information played back in their minds, often reading aloud or engaging in self-talk. Kinesthetic processors, on the other hand, are hands-on learners who prefer to learn through touch and action. Identifying an individual's processing style can be done by observing their eye movements when asked neutral questions.

By understanding how individuals process information, we can tailor our communication to match their preferred style. For visual processors, incorporating visual aids such as diagrams or charts can be effective. Auditory processors may benefit from discussions or presentations accompanied by audio elements. Kinesthetic processors thrive when provided with hands-on experiences or practical demonstrations. Adapting our communication to align with the recipient's processing style enhances understanding and engagement.

Part 2: Coursera's Business Model - Revolutionizing Online Education

Coursera, a prominent online learning platform, has transformed the landscape of education by offering courses from renowned educational institutions and industry professionals. Unlike some of its competitors, Coursera focuses on partnering with top universities worldwide, ensuring high-quality educational content. This strategic approach has contributed to the platform's exponential growth and success.

Coursera generates revenue through various channels. While instructors and professors are not directly paid by Coursera, the platform shares revenue with the institution hosting the course. This incentivizes universities to collaborate with Coursera, as it provides them with a platform to reach a larger audience and generate additional income. Coursera also offers degree programs that are more affordable compared to traditional on-campus degrees, making education accessible to a wider demographic.
